Quickbase provides a no-code operational agility platform that enables organizations to improve operations through real-time insights and automation across complex processes and disparate systems. Our goal is to help companies achieve operational agility—to be more responsive to customers, more engaging to employees and as adaptable as possible to what’s next. Quickbase helps nearly 6,000 customers, including over 80 percent of the Fortune 50. Visit www.quickbase.com to learn more.

  • How to think about HTML responsive images
    Having the server decide the image format based on the accept header is simpler. Services like https://imagekit.io/ (no affiliation) can do that for you. - Source: Hacker News / about 2 months ago

  • Best way to store and serve images with node and mongodb
    Use any third-party service to store images like Cloudinary , imagekit etc... And store image URLs in your database. If you have fewer images you keep image URLs directly in your APIs. Source: over 1 year ago
